Transaction 38f18a9cf1e28dbe4a2191f02e6b786475a8659c55a1664af427da16650117b4
1 Input
1 Output
-
38f18a9cf1e28dbe4a2191f02e6b786475a8659c55a1664af427da16650117b4:0
- value
- 23274945
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b27ac906226010c3573095beb9d7a1493619ddd4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HGiNR3WFpXZgnciFuZJZPdGCukBv71KSu